Description Mounir Lamouri 2014-02-17 16:28:16 UTC
The relation between primary and secondary is currently based on the angle between both. We might want to change it to be less strict. -primary could be the preferred orientation of that type. For example, on a phone, landscape-primary would be the landscape orientation the user prefer (for a right-handed user, likely 90 degree anti-clockwise and 90 degree clockwise for a left-handed person).
Comment 1 Mounir Lamouri 2014-03-14 20:26:44 UTC
*-primary and *-secondary is now entirely up to the UA:
